    Below are some possible causes of periorbital edema.

    Allergic reactions

    Allergic reactions can cause skin inflammation around the eyes, and red and watery eyes.

    In this case, taking antihistamines may reduce the symptoms.

    If swelling around the eye is accompanied by other facial swelling or difficulty breathing, this may be anaphylactic shock.

    Anaphylactic shock is an extreme allergic reaction and is a medical emergency.

    A person experiencing anaphylactic shock needs emergency medical treatment.

    If a person thinks this may be the case, they should call emergency services without delay.

    Aging

    As a person ages, their body expels more water throughout the day.

    This can lead to the body trying to retain more fluid, causing swelling around the eyes.
